Two novel octupolar organoboron compounds, namely 1,3,5-tris[5-(dimesitylboryl)thiophen-2-yl]terthienobenzene and 1,3,5-tris[4-(dimesitylboryl)phenyl]terthienobenzene, symmetrically extended from terthienobenzene (TTB) with dimesitylboryl groups as electron acceptors have been synthesized. These TTB derivatives exhibited strong blue-green emission in common solvents under single or two-photon excitation (Φfl > 30%), as well as good thermal stability (Tg > 150 °C).
